What is an example of simulation in the classroom?
When students use a model of behavior to gain a better understanding of that behavior, they are doing a simulation. For example: When students are assigned roles as buyers and sellers of some good and asked to strike deals to exchange the good, they are learning about market behavior by simulating a market.What is the benefit of games in the classroom?

Simulations and games enable the learner to gain insight into real world situations in an authentic and engaging way without the need to leave the classroom. They allow students to experiment and see the impact of their decisions and actions within a safe environment and without any real world consequences.What is using simulation and games method of teaching?

Some examples of computer simulation modeling familiar to most of us include: weather forecasting, flight simulators used for training pilots, and car crash modeling.What is simulated teaching how it helps in real classroom situation?
Simulated teaching is a design to replicate real situation as closely as desired, where students assume the roles of teacher. As the simulation proceeds, students respond to changes within the situation by studying the consequences of their decisions and subsequent actions.How does simulated teaching helps a teacher in real life classroom situation?
Simulated teaching allows you to identify and solve problems throughout a lesson. Simulated teaching aids in developing good classroom communication skills in teaching assistants. Simulated teaching helps to teach assistants to comprehend and cope with behavioral issues in school.What are the three advantages of role playing and simulation?

A job simulation, or work simulation, is an employment test where potential employees are asked to complete tasks expected from them on the job. For example, for a secretary position, a job simulation might include typing a dictation or completing forms.What is the difference between simulation and game?
